Pepe Wallet address
PnY2Bj7bS4UhZpoJ6P9fa1P2CTF8a5wN3Z
Transactions
2
Total PEPE Received
6,444.7698787
Total PEPE Sent
6,444.7698787
PEPE Balance
0.00